We just started using these sight word rings. I call students to my back table randomly throughout the day to read their words to me. Every time they are able to identify the sight word, they get a "dot" on that card.

I also let them pick what shape they wanted their ring booklets to be.

This week we have also talked about the term "estimation" and that it means a "good guess." We used non-standard measurement items (like cubes) to estimate how tall things were in our classroom.

Ms. Johnson, our gifted resource teacher came in and read the book, "Scribbles." After the story, each child was given their own red unique scribble and they had to create a picture from it. I was so impressed with what they came up with!!

Seasonal Scientists

Today we put on our "science goggles" and went outside to examine a Fall tree more closely.


Here is the tree we observed.

We came inside and drew our observations of Fall trees and leaves in our Fall Journals.

Some of the students even chose to glue their leaves next to their artwork.
